body 							{ background-color:#2D81FD; font-family: Trebuchet MS,Arial, Tahoma, Verdana; font-size:0.9em;  color: #550141; margin:0px; padding:10px 10px 0px 20px;	}

#frame 						{ background:url(/img/bg_frame.gif) top center no-repeat; }
#mainflash				{ margin:0 auto; padding:0px;width:1000px; position:relative;}



body.iframe 			{ background:url(/img/iframe_gradient.png) top left repeat-x; } 

body.newsletter 	{ background:url(/img/iframe_newsletter.png) top left repeat-x; } 
body.ape01 				{ background:url(/img/iframe_ape01.png) top left repeat-x; } 
body.ape02 				{ background:url(/img/iframe_ape02.png) top left repeat-x; } 

body.pig 				{ background:url(/img/iframe_pig.png) top left no-repeat fixed; } 
body.elefant 				{ background:url(/img/iframe_elefant.png) top left no-repeat fixed; } 

body.deluxe 				{ background:url(/img/iframe_deluxe.png) top left no-repeat fixed; } 
body.junior 				{ background:url(/img/iframe_junior.png) top left no-repeat fixed; } 
body.vegis 				{ background:url(/img/iframe_vegi.png) top left no-repeat fixed; } 

body.clown 				{ background:url(/img/iframe_clown.png) top left no-repeat fixed; } 
body.stars 				{ background:url(/img/iframe_stars.png) top left no-repeat fixed; } 
body.glocki 			{ background:url(/img/iframe_glocki.png) top left no-repeat fixed; } 


#windowbar 									{	position:absolute; top:0px; left:680px; width:105px; background-color: #D5D5D5; color: white; padding: 4px;	}
#windowbar a, a.noimage 		{ padding:0px; background:none; display:block;}



.main_column			{ margin: auto; width: 100%;  color: #333333; padding: 20px;}

	
label							{ float: left; width: 150px;}
p a								{ text-decoration: none; padding-left:25px; background: url(/img/a_arrow.gif) 0px 3px no-repeat; color: #2D81FD; font-weight:bold;}
p									{ margin: 0px 0px 10px 0px;} 
img								{ border: none;}
div.frame					{border:2px solid white; padding:5px; float:left; margin-right:10px}		

.ecard_list, .list				{ float: left; margin-right: 25px; margin-bottom:15px;}
.ecard_l					{ float: left; width: 450px; margin:0px; }
.ecard_r					{ float: right; width: 300px;margin:0px; }

.quest 						{ font-weight:bold; font-size:16px; margin:0px 0px 15px 0px; }

.wallpaper_image		{ float: left; margin-right: 25px; margin-bottom: 30px;}
.wallpaper_links		{ float: left; width: 170px;}

.list_box					{ float: left; margin: 25px 25px 20px 0px; width: 320px;}

h1 								{ color:#039B03; text-transform:uppercase; font-size:30px; margin:0px 0px 14px 0px}
h2 								{ color:#2D81FD; margin:0px 0px 14px 0px; font-size:22px; }
h3 								{ color:#550141; margin:8px 0px 8px 0px; font-size:18px; }


form p 							{ margin: 0px 0px 3px 0px}
form 								{margin:0px}
form input 					{ font-size:12px; border:1px solid;}
form select					{ font-size:12px; }

form input.i200 			{ width:200px;}

form label {text-align:right; padding-right:15px; }



form input.noborder {border:0px none;}

.error							{ color: red;}

.clearl 						{ clear:left;}

#recommend {float:left; width: 420px; }
#recommend label {width:170px;}
